Understanding the Value of Working With Licensed Contractors
Why Licensing Matters
When it involves building projects, working with certified professionals isn't just a rule; it's necessary. Certified specialists have actually undergone the needed training and evaluations called for by regional authorities. This makes sure that they have the knowledge and abilities to execute high quality job safely and efficiently.
The Dangers of Hiring Unlicensed Contractors
Hiring unlicensed professionals can cause different concerns:
- Legal Problems: If something fails, you may not be safeguarded under warranty. Quality Concerns: Unlicensed workers may lack the required skills. Insurance Issues: You might be accountable for accidents that happen on your property.
Verification Procedures for Licensing
To validate a contractor's permit:
Visit your state's licensing board website. Input the service provider's name or company number. Check for any type of complaints or violations.How to Find Trustworthy Service Providers in Your Area: A Comprehensive Guide

The Contract Signing Process
Importance of Created Contracts
Never employ a service provider without a composed arrangement outlining all aspects of the job:
- Scope of work Timeline Payment terms
Key Clauses to Consist of in Your Contract
Your contract ought to consist of stipulations such as:
Payment schedule Start and completion dates Description of products usedUnderstanding Payment Frameworks for Construction Projects
Common Repayment Approaches Used by Contractors
Most specialists will certainly request repayment via several of these approaches:
Upfront down payment (typically 10%-- 30%) Progress repayments based upon milestones Final payment upon completionNegotiating Payment Terms
Negotiation can frequently result in much better terms:
- Discuss how much you agree to pay upfront. Consider paying smaller amounts as jobs are finished satisfactorily.

1: Exactly how do I recognize if my professional is licensed?
You can verify a specialist's license via your regional licensing board's website by entering their name or business number.
2: What need to I seek when vetting prospective contractors?
Look for experience pertinent to your project kind, verified licenses/insurance, previous customer recommendations, and on-line reviews.
3: Exactly how do I handle differences with my contractor?
Start by documenting problems extensively after that connect straight with your professional concerning concerns before thinking about legal actions.
4: Is it normal for contractors to ask for ahead of time payments?
Yes, lots of service providers require upfront repayments ranging from 10%-- 30% as part of their settlement structure; nevertheless, this ought to be gone over beforehand.
5: What happens if my job looks at budget?
Discuss budget plan restrictions upfront and ensure this is included in your agreement; if expenses go beyond assumptions due to unpredicted scenarios, set how those prices will be handled prior to proceeding further.
6: Can I terminate my professional if I'm unsatisfied with their work?
If performance is unacceptable regardless of resolving concerns several times, refer back to your contract concerning discontinuation stipulations prior to making such decisions formally using composed notice.
